Confident Iwobi expects to be fit for Atletico rematch

Alex Iwobi was left on the bench for Arsenal-s first Europa League semi-final against Atletico but despite picking up a hamstring injury against Man united on Sunday, the Nigerian international believes he will be fit and ready to play on Thursday. He said: “I am still being assessed but to me it is good and I will be okay,”

“We will have to wait and see but I believe I will be okay and fit.”

It was unfortunate that Mhkitaryan also suffered a recurrence of his injury on Sunday as well, so there is still a chance that Iwobi could play as the boss will have to choose between Wilshere, Maitland-Niles, Xhaka and Iwobi for the midfield spots alongside Aaron Ramsey. On Sunday’s form I would probably choose AM-N and Iwobi, but the Boss has never listened to me!

If Iwobi does get picked he thinks that the Gunners are very confident we can get a result in Madrid, especially with the added incentive of it being wenger’s last chance of a trophy with Arsenal. He said: “We are really motivated – especially by what he has done for the club,”

“We are trying to make him end the season on a high.

“And not just for him but for ourselves as well so we are doing our best to get the result.

“We are very confident. We were unfortunate not to get the result we wanted against them in the first leg but we are very confident and believe we can go to the final.”

It’s good that the players are in fine fettle and confident mood. We certainly bossed Atletico at the Emirates but in Spain with eleven men on the field it could be a very different game. But then again, we have nothing to lose…
